Animal enrichment is a vital aspect of modern zoo management. It refers to dynamic strategies and activities designed to stimulate animals physically and mentally, preventing boredom and encouraging natural behaviors. From puzzle feeders to ropes and branches that mimic wild environments, enrichment activities are essential for animals’ well-being. These practices are not only enjoyable for animals but are crucial for maintaining healthy and active habitats in captivity.
